Businiess name:  Cafe Europa
Review by:  joan s.
Review content: 
First of all, I don't believe most reviews I read on citysearch, positive or negative, too much anger. There is too much to be said about this Europa. The coffee and pastries are delicious, depending on the Barista, and the muffins are a homemade work of art. But, I find their politics very conservative and a little odd for Capitol Hill. No W stickers though. So, here's the funny thing, we have been coming here for about 3 years now and they have never ever been rude or grouchy with me or my partner, just a little uptight about their policies. In fact I would say they have been oddly generous and gracious, far beyond almost every other coffiter on the hill that just want's your money. The typical Seattle Barista is cold & impersonal, we all know this, I think it's part of their training. Anyway, they even let us run a tab! Try that on 15th or Broadway. lol. Instead of rushing to a harsh judgment, I inquire. Isn't that what being an intelligent liberal-progressive is all about? I'm sorry but the signs don't offend me, but that's because I actually asked them the reasoning behind them. For the most part I think they're just kinda silly. I've heard crazy rumors from people who admit that they have never even been in the place. Some of these reviews seem too personally pointed; its hard to believe their sincerity. What do all of our high open-minded principals stand for? I appreciate ALL diversity and strong conviction whether or not I agree. I think some of my fellow reviewers obviously do not?
